ability to hide repository information
We need to share our labs and artifacts with many users outside of our team and also sometimes with external customers.
As the repository is private and hosted on internal servers, for security reasons we would like ability to hide the repository source information for all the users. It would be nice if
1. Go to repository option [click 3 dots against your repository] can be disabled.
2. Ability to disable the click on selected repositories can be provided, so user cannot see repository details in configuration.
Thanks for your suggestion! There are some ways to solve these problems today: 1) for “go to repository” menu item from the three dots, you can control the permission at the repository level (i.e. don’t give users read permission to your repo), so that even if users click that item, they will get access deny when trying to access the repo. 2) to disallow users to see repo details, you can create a custom role and remove the read permission to the repo details from the built-in DevTest Labs User role. Do these solutions work with you? If not, could you explain the reason so that we can design the right solution for you?
If the option to hide repository through context menu [3 dots] is provided, that would make life a lot easier. Showing access deny message gives bad user experience and creating custom role looks like will require a lot of efforts considering number of subscriptions and labs we create/maintain and no option available to configure it through portal.